At the Feb. 18, 2025 Zoning Hearing Master meeting, applicants asked to rezone parcels taken out of PD 06‑1721 in Riverview to standard zoning (AS‑1 and RSC‑6) with access restrictions; one companion case was continued to March 24 to synchronize owner agreements and board scheduling.

At the Feb. 18, 2025 Zoning Hearing Master meeting the master heard two companion standard rezoning cases that would take parcels out of Planned Development (PD 06‑1721) in the Riverview area and convert them to standard residential zoning with restrictions on access.

The first case (standard rezoning 25‑0177) would rezone roughly 9.85 acres removed from the PD to AS‑1 (agricultural single‑family at 1 unit per 2.5 acres) with a restriction limiting access for the affected folios to a single point on Riverview Drive.
